Erinomaisen verkkokasinon luominen edellyttää enemmän kuin laajan pelivalikoiman. Sen toimintakyky ja helppokäyttöisyys muodostuvat vankasta teknisestä pohjasta. Tässä välimuistinhallinnalla on keskeinen rooli. Boomzino Casinolla cache-hallinta on käytännöllinen työkalu käyttäjäkokemuksen parantamiseksi. Se ei ole pelkkä tekninen yksityiskohta, vaan se, mikä mahdollistaa sulavat liikkeet, nopeat latausajat ja luotettavan pelikokemuksen millä tahansa laitteella. Tässä tekstissä selvitämme, millä tavalla tämä kokonaisuus toimii käytännössä ja kuinka se aikaansaa tasaisuutta ja nopeutta.

Välimuistin perusteet ja niiden merkitys suorituskyvylle

Puskurimuisti on vikkelä väliaikaismuisti, joka varastoi usein käytettyjä tietoja helposti saatavilla olevana boomzino-casino.eu. Verkkopalveluissa tämä koskee staattisia tiedostoja kuten kuvia, JavaScriptiä ja CSS:ää, sekä dynaamisesti luotuja datalohkoja. Boomzino Casinon ratkaisu perustuu useitasoiseen välimuististrategiaan. Jokainen taso on räätälöity omaan tehtäväänsä. Tämä monikerroksinen lähestymistapa alentaa palvelimen kuormaa ja lyhentää viiveitä huomattavasti. Pelaaja havaitsee eron sivuston nopeana navigointina, pelien nopeana latautumisena ja vakaana istuntona jopa ruuhka-aikoina.

Tehokas välimuistin hallinta selvittää kaksi käytännön ongelmaa: kaistanleveyden kulutuksen ja palvelimen viiveen. Kun pelaaja esimerkiksi avaa pelin etusivun, suuri osa sen resursseista varastoituu hänen omaan laitteeseensa. Seuraavalla kerralla nämä elementit otetaan paikallisesta muistista, eikä verkosta uudelleen. Boomzino huolehtii, että nämä tallennetut objektit säilyvät turvallisesti ajan tasalla. Pelaaja ei siis törmää vanhentunutta tai rikkinäistä sisältöä. Nopeuden ja ajantasaisuuden tasapaino on äärimmäisen tärkeä.

Tekniset edut pelaajakokemuksessa

Tässä kuvatun arkkitehtuurin todelliset hyödyt pelaajalle ovat lukuisalla tavalla todettavissa. Se varmistaa nopean alkuisen sisällön latautumisen (First Contentful Paint), mikä synnyttää hyvän ensivaikutelman. Sivuston katselu ja pelien vaihtaminen toimivat, koska yhteisiä resursseja ei tarvitse ladata uudestaan. Lisäksi se alentaa datan kulutusta mobiililaitteilla, mikä on taloudellisesti ja käytännössä hyödyllistä monille.

  1. Pelaamisen aikaisen vakauden parantaminen:
  2. Joustavuus ruuhka-aikoina:
  3. Paranneltu mobiilikokemus:

Järjestelmä tarjoaa myös paremman suojan palvelunestohyökkäyksiä (DDoS) vastaan. Kun CDN ja välimuisti hoitavat suuren osan liikenteestä, alkuperäinen palvelin on paremmin suojattu. Tämä turvallisuusetu tukee pitämään palvelun käyttökuntoisena kaikille käyttäjille. Kaikki nämä tekniset yksityiskohdat liittyvät huomaamattomaksi, mutta elintärkeäksi osaksi luotettavaa pelialustaa.

Boomzino Casinon cache-arkkitehtuuri

Boomzino Casinon teknisessä pohjassa on nykyaikainen, pilvipohjainen infrastruktuuri, joka skaalautuu tarpeen mukaan. Välimuistin hallinta on suunniteltu tämän ympärille soveltaen useita eri tekniikoita. Ratkaisu yhdistää selaimen välimuistin, palvelinpuolen välimuistin ja sisällönjakeluverkon (CDN) maailmanlaajuiseen nopeuteen. Jokainen kerros suorittaa tietyistä tehtävistä, mikä sallii tarkan säätelyn.

  • CDN-verkosto:
  • Palvelinpuolen välimuisti:
  • Aggressiivinen selaimen välimuististrategia:

Tämän järjestelmän sydämessä on älyllinen mitätöintimekanismi. Kun sisältöä päivitetään – esimerkiksi lisätään uusi peli – välimuistijärjestelmä erottaa muutoksen. Se poistaa vanhat välimuistitiedot automaattisesti. Tämä sattuu käyttäjälle näkymättömästä taustalla. Jokainen havaitsee aina oikean version sivustosta ilman, että välimuistia tarvitsee tyhjentää käsin. Koko prosessi on automatisoitu ja jatkuvasti seurattu.

Optimointi eri päätelaitteille ja verkkoyhteyksille

Tämän päivän pelaajat suosivat erilaisia alustoja ja internetyhteyksiä. Boomzino Casinon kätkömuistin hallinta on suunniteltu optimoimaan kokemus jokaisessa olosuhteessa. Alusta havaitsee ilman eri toimenpiteitä asiakkaan laitteen, verkkoselaimen ja verkkoyhteyden nopeuden. Se virittää resurssien tarjoamista kyseisten parametrien mukaan. Esimerkiksi mobiililaitteelle, jolla on heikko 3G-yhteys, toimitetaan lisää pakattuja kuvia ja kevyempiä JavaScript-paketteja vastakohtana pöytätietokoneeseen nopeatempoisen kaapeliyhteyden yhteydessä.

  • Mukautuva kuvan tarjonta:
  • Ohjelmakoodin pilkonta (Code Splitting):
  • Service Worker -tekniikka:

Tämä virittäminen ei ole muuttumatonta, vaan dynaamista ja toimii jokaisen pelaajakerran kuluessa. Alusta tallentaa anonymisoituja tehotietoja eri pelaajaryhmistä. Näiden tietojen avulla pystymme jatkuvasti tarkentaa cache-sääntöjä ja sisältöjen painotusta. Seurauksena asiakas kotimaisella syrjäseudulla rajoitetulla yhteydellä ja pelaaja Euroopan mantereella pääkaupungissa valokuituverkossa nauttivat kumpikin henkilökohtaisesti parhaimman saavutettavissa olevan kokemuksen omissa tilanteissaan.

Tulevaisuuden näkymiä ja kehitystrendejä

Välimuistin hallinta kehittyy koko ajan. Lukuisat teknologiat näyttävät lupaaviksi tulevaisuuden kannalta. Yhtenä oleellinen kehityssuunta on yhä älykkäämpi ennakkoon lataus (predictive prefetching). Kyseisessä menetelmässä koneoppimista hyödynnettäisiin arvaamaan, millaisia sisältöjä pelaaja luultavasti tarvitsee seuraavaksi, ja ne haetaan taustalle etukäteen. Toisena merkittävä kohde on WebAssemblyn (Wasm) parempi liittäminen välimuistijärjestelmään, mikä tekisi mahdolliseksi yhä nopeampaa koodin suorituksen selaimessa.

Lisäksi edge computingin leviäminen muokkaa välimuistimaailmaa. Boomzino kartoittaa mahdollisuuksia sijoittaa enemmän toimintaa ja välimuistia yhä lähelle käyttäjää, CDN-verkoston ääripisteisiin. Tämä lyhentäisi viivettä nykyisestäänkin, sallien likimain reaaliaikaisen interaktion kompleksisissakin live-peleissä. Oleellisena ongelmana on tasapainon löytäminen erittäin nopeuden sekä tietosuojan ja tietoturvan kesken, kun dataa prosessoidaan hajautetummin.

  1. Tekoälypohjaisen tehostamisen laajentaminen:
  2. Progressive Web App (PWA) -ominaisuuksien vahvistaminen:
  3. Ympäristötehokkuuden tehostaminen:

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*